G7 announces $39bn financial aid to Ukraine in 2023
[ad_1]
Following the talks that ended on February 23 in Bangalore, India, the heads of the Ministries of Finance and Central Banks of the Group of Seven countries adopted a resolution according to which the G7 will allocate about $40 billion in financial assistance to Ukraine in 2023.
“For 2023, we have increased our budgetary and economic support commitments to $39 billion,” the G7 final document says.
It is specified that this amount will be allocated “in accordance with the needs of the government of Ukraine.”
